Quote:
Originally Posted by VeqIR View Post
Even if you were to take (total component points)/(matches), it would be hard to draw comparisons between teams between events due to the difference in the number of teams at an event, difficulty of schedule and average scoring ability of alliance members. For instance, you'd expect average scores to be higher for a District Championship than your average regional because those teams have already been selected to that event based on their performance. This means that absolute component point values would be higher for a robot attending a DCMP vs. if they were in your "average" regional.
In many ways, performances aren't comparable across events. All ranking values are ~2/3* the result of your alliance partners' performance, +/- any synergistic value between the individual teams. As a result, rankings are inflated/deflated based on your alliance partners at a given event.

As a result, none of the scouting done before champs can really determine anything except for general claims, but it's fun and interesting nonetheless



*This isn't ever true, but for the average robot, it's close.
